There's some kind of ropy white stuff coming out of the vent. Is that just poop or intestines?
 
Quote:
So sorry it didnt make it.... I would say it didnt asorb the yolk sac all the way.. As far as passing sometimes they just die.. I have a rule at my house that I will not help a chick out of the egg.. i need to know that it is strong enough to make it....
